What years did Yamaha make the Rhino 660?

The Yamaha Rhino was a popular off-road vehicle produced by Yamaha Motor Company from 2004 to 2012. It was designed for a driver and passenger with two-wheel drive and four-wheel drive.

Why did Yamaha stop making the rhino?

Nearly five months after the U.S. Consumer Product Safety Commission (CPSC) began looking into safety problems with the Yamaha Rhino side-by-side ATV, Yamaha has agreed to suspend sales and recall vehicles sold since Fall 2003, so that repairs can be made to improve the vehicle’s stability and reduce the risk that it …

What is the horsepower in a Yamaha Rhino 660?

Well, stock Rhino 660 is about 23hp. Basic 686 is about 35 with carb and exhaust. More elaborate 686s with head porting are about 42 hp. 686s with aggressive porting/cams are up over 50 hp.
